HC Deb 09 March 1979 vol 963 cc840-1W
Mr. Wyn Roberts

asked the Secretary of State for Trade what consideration has been given within the European Community of the amount of export subsidy on Italian washing machines; and what action he proposes to take to prevent unfair competition.

Mr. Meacher

No substantiated proof of export subsidies on Italian washing machines imported into the United Kingdom has been produced, so the issue has not come up for consideration within the Community. I am not aware that any member State has lodged a complaint about such subsidies. The Government remain in close consultation with United Kingdom industry and would look with urgency at any evidence that could be put forward.
